Abstract (en)

[origin: WO03035249A1] The oxidic material suitable for use as a hydrogenation catalyst contains a) bivalent and trivalent iron, the atomic ratio of bivalent iron to trivalent iron ranging from more than 0.5 to 5.5, and b) oxygen as a counter ion to the bivalent and trivalent iron.
